other:win7apps
Differences
This shows you the differences between two versions of the page.
|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
| other:win7apps [2014/11/06 11:21] – More cygwin stuff jypeter | other:win7apps [2018/03/13 15:18] (current) – Replaced asterix with obelix everywhere jypeter | ||
|---|---|---|---|
| Line 20: | Line 20: | ||
| * from //Canopy Packages// (note: if you know that you have an academic license, but you only get // | * from //Canopy Packages// (note: if you know that you have an academic license, but you only get // | ||
| * Click on //Updates NN// again, and install them, if some new updates are available | * Click on //Updates NN// again, and install them, if some new updates are available | ||
| + | |||
| + | ===== VcXsrv Windows X Server ===== | ||
| + | |||
| + | <note important> | ||
| + | |||
| + | Web & Download: http:// | ||
| + | |||
| + | ==== Setup ==== | ||
| + | |||
| + | * Start //XLaunch// to configure VcXsrv | ||
| + | * Select //One large window//, then //Next// | ||
| + | * Select //Open session via XDMCP//, then //Next// | ||
| + | * Select //Connect to host **obelix**// | ||
| + | * Use the settings specified below, then //Next// | ||
| + | * Select // | ||
| + | * **Unselect** //Native opengl//, unless you know what you are doing! | ||
| + | * FIXME We should try to keep it selected and check if '' | ||
| + | * Click on //Save configuration// | ||
| + | |||
| + | ==== Notes ==== | ||
| + | |||
| + | * Once you have started VcXsrv and logged in with you account on one of the obelix servers, it is highly suggested to **activate the windows wireframe moving mode** by typing:\\ '' | ||
| + | * If you just need to run an //X server// (instead of using XDMCP), e.g. when you are outside LSCE, just start //VcXsrv// from the Windows Start Menu | ||
| ===== Cygwin-X ===== | ===== Cygwin-X ===== | ||
| - | < | + | < |
| Web & Download: http:// | Web & Download: http:// | ||
| Line 35: | Line 58: | ||
| * Select a scratch directory for downloading the installation packages\\ e.g. < | * Select a scratch directory for downloading the installation packages\\ e.g. < | ||
| * Accept the //Direct Connection// | * Accept the //Direct Connection// | ||
| - | * Select a nearby mirror\\ e.g. http:// | + | * Select a nearby mirror\\ e.g. http:// |
| * The Select Packages window should start with the Category view. If this is not the case, click several times on the View button to select the Category view | * The Select Packages window should start with the Category view. If this is not the case, click several times on the View button to select the Category view | ||
| * When you select a package, the dependencies will automatically be selected as well | * When you select a package, the dependencies will automatically be selected as well | ||
| * View => Pending will display the selected packages and the dependencies that will be downloaded | * View => Pending will display the selected packages and the dependencies that will be downloaded | ||
| * Select the following packages, from: | * Select the following packages, from: | ||
| - | * X11: xorg-server, | + | * X11: xorg-server, |
| * X11 optional: mesa-demos, x11perf | * X11 optional: mesa-demos, x11perf | ||
| * Net: openssh | * Net: openssh | ||
| Line 55: | Line 78: | ||
| * Click on the //View// button till it displays // | * Click on the //View// button till it displays // | ||
| * Click Next and accept the suggested extra packages (dependencies) | * Click Next and accept the suggested extra packages (dependencies) | ||
| - | * Click Next and wait for the download | + | * Click Next and wait for the download |
| + | * Warning! If you get the //unable to extract / | ||
| * Accept the default icons creations and exit | * Accept the default icons creations and exit | ||
| Line 63: | Line 87: | ||
| * An xterm should appear | * An xterm should appear | ||
| - | * Note: this will **NOT** work if you already have a running X server connected to the LSCE asterix | + | * Note: this will **NOT** work if you already have a running X server connected to the LSCE obelix |
| * Type ' | * Type ' | ||
| - | * In the notification zone, right-click on the X icon and choose About. You should get Version 1.16.0 (2014-08-16) or higher | + | * In the notification zone, right-click on the X icon and choose About. You should get Version 1.16.1 (2014-10-17) or higher |
| * Type ' | * Type ' | ||
| * Type ' | * Type ' | ||
| - | * Type 'ssh -Y < | + | * Type 'ssh -Y < |
| * do the ' | * do the ' | ||
| * do the ' | * do the ' | ||
| - | * exit asterix | + | * exit obelix |
| * More tests with x11perf?? | * More tests with x11perf?? | ||
| Line 83: | Line 107: | ||
| * You can find the installed version of Cygwin at the top of the file (e.g. //Release: 1.16.0.0//) | * You can find the installed version of Cygwin at the top of the file (e.g. //Release: 1.16.0.0//) | ||
| * Discussion: http:// | * Discussion: http:// | ||
| + | |||
| + | ==== Cygwin-X tips and tricks ==== | ||
| + | |||
| + | === Where are the directories? | ||
| + | |||
| + | * You can use '' | ||
| + | * The Linux root (''/'' | ||
| + | * The '' | ||
| + | |||
| + | === Solving Cygwin directories access rights === | ||
| + | |||
| + | You may encounter Windows access rights problem when using cygwin: | ||
| + | * you don't have the correct ownership or enough rights to remove c:\cygwin | ||
| + | * when starting cygwin/X, you get an error message saying that you can't write/ | ||
| + | * ... | ||
| + | |||
| + | These problems can be solved with cygwin! | ||
| + | * Start a cygwin shell with administrator rights\\ '' | ||
| + | * Use standard Linux commands to check and fix the access rights | ||
| + | * '' | ||
| + | * e.g., to solve the XWin.0.log above, you can use: '' | ||
| + | |||
| + | ==== Uninstalling Cygwin-X ==== | ||
| + | |||
| + | You may have to uninstall Cygwin-X if you want to really restart from scratch, or because of some unforeseen technical problems | ||
| + | |||
| + | * Official uninstall instructions: | ||
| + | * An interesting thread about uninstall: http:// | ||
| + | * Look for hints in there if you get some weird access rights problems! | ||
| + | * Some Windows command lines have some potential: '' | ||
| ==== Using Cygwin-X at LSCE ==== | ==== Using Cygwin-X at LSCE ==== | ||
| - | We use //XDMCP query on asterix// in order to open a full Linux environment running on one of the asterix | + | We use //XDMCP query on obelix// in order to open a full Linux environment running on one of the obelix |
| Use the following steps to create a shortcut on your desktop that you can use to start Cygwin-X in XDMCP mode: | Use the following steps to create a shortcut on your desktop that you can use to start Cygwin-X in XDMCP mode: | ||
| * Right-click on the desktop and choose //New --> Shortcut// | * Right-click on the desktop and choose //New --> Shortcut// | ||
| * Choose the target of the shortcut: // | * Choose the target of the shortcut: // | ||
| - | * Do not forget to add the extra options to the shortcut, so that it looks like:\\ // | + | * Do not forget to add the extra options to the shortcut, so that it looks like:\\ // |
| * Note: the //-wgl// argument is optional. It may (or not) give you some increased performance | * Note: the //-wgl// argument is optional. It may (or not) give you some increased performance | ||
| - | * Select a name for the shorcut: //Asterix64//, //Asterix//, etc... | + | * Select a name for the shorcut: //Obelix64//, //Obelix//, etc... |
| - | Once you have started Cygwin and logged in with you account on one of the asterix | + | Once you have started Cygwin and logged in with you account on one of the obelix |
| ==== Trying to have Cygwin-X work faster on Win7+Intel HDxxx cards ==== | ==== Trying to have Cygwin-X work faster on Win7+Intel HDxxx cards ==== | ||
| - | * Activate wireframe mode\\ '' | + | * Activate wireframe mode\\ '' |
| + | * Check if other metacity parameters should be set? | ||
| + | * http:// | ||
| + | * [[http:// | ||
| * [[http:// | * [[http:// | ||
| + | * Start with '' | ||
| * Check the performance and basic parameters with: glxgears -info | * Check the performance and basic parameters with: glxgears -info | ||
| * [[http:// | * [[http:// | ||
| Line 108: | Line 166: | ||
| * What can we do with cygserver-config ? | * What can we do with cygserver-config ? | ||
| * Enable //MIT-SHM extension// ([[http:// | * Enable //MIT-SHM extension// ([[http:// | ||
| + | * http:// | ||
| + | |||
| + | ===== Panoply ==== | ||
| + | |||
| + | You can use Panoply to work with **NetCDF** data (and some other geo-referenced data) if you just need a // | ||
| + | |||
| + | Web & Download: http:// | ||
| + | |||
| + | {{: | ||
| + | |||
| + | ===== GIMP ==== | ||
| + | |||
| + | Web: http:// | ||
| + | |||
| + | Download: http:// | ||
| ===== Gnu emacs + GnuWin DiffUtils ===== | ===== Gnu emacs + GnuWin DiffUtils ===== | ||
| Line 113: | Line 186: | ||
| ==== Download ==== | ==== Download ==== | ||
| - | - http:// | + | - Emacs installer for Windows: |
| - | - http:// | + | - Recompiled diff programs for Windows (needed for the //ediff// mode): |
| - | - {{: | + | - JYP's .emacs file: {{: |
| + | - Annotated reference card of the emacs text editor: {{: | ||
| ==== Configuration ==== | ==== Configuration ==== | ||
| Line 132: | Line 206: | ||
| ==== Testing the tramp mode ==== | ==== Testing the tramp mode ==== | ||
| - | Try to open a remote file, in order to check if tramp works correctly\\ e.g. /< | + | Try to open a remote file, in order to check if tramp works correctly\\ e.g. /< |
| You will probably get the following error: Couldn' | You will probably get the following error: Couldn' | ||
| Line 144: | Line 218: | ||
| - Start Emacs | - Start Emacs | ||
| - | ==== Notes ==== | + | ==== Misc. emacs related notes ==== |
| + | |||
| + | === Windows specific notes === | ||
| * Installing the DiffUtils packages makes it possible to use the emacs Tools => Compare (ediff) menu | * Installing the DiffUtils packages makes it possible to use the emacs Tools => Compare (ediff) menu | ||
| * If you get the following error when starting emacs\\ error: The directory `~/ | * If you get the following error when starting emacs\\ error: The directory `~/ | ||
| + | |||
| + | === Other notes === | ||
| + | |||
| + | * Commenting/ | ||
| + | * Improving python support: https:// | ||
| + | * Not tested! FIXME | ||
| ===== QtGrace ===== | ===== QtGrace ===== | ||
| Line 160: | Line 243: | ||
| * Go to '' | * Go to '' | ||
| - | ===== Kies (Samsung) ===== | + | ===== Samsung |
| - | Web & Download: http:// | + | * Smart Switch: http:// |
| + | |||
| + | * Kies & Kies3, for older phones: http:// | ||
| + | |||
| + | ===== Malwarebytes Anti-Malware ===== | ||
| + | |||
| + | Web & Download: https:// | ||
| ===== Putty ===== | ===== Putty ===== | ||
| Line 169: | Line 258: | ||
| Download: http:// | Download: http:// | ||
| + | |||
| + | More information: | ||
| ==== Configuring and using pageant ==== | ==== Configuring and using pageant ==== | ||
| + | |||
| + | FIXME | ||
| ==== Notes ==== | ==== Notes ==== | ||
| Line 186: | Line 279: | ||
| ===== Microsoft synctoy ===== | ===== Microsoft synctoy ===== | ||
| - | <note tip>This is a free and easy to install backup program that will only copy new/ | + | <note tip>This is a free and easy to install backup program that will only copy new/ |
| Web & Download: http:// | Web & Download: http:// | ||
| Line 194: | Line 287: | ||
| The idea is to create pairs of folders (//left// folder and //right// folder) and to keep them synchronized | The idea is to create pairs of folders (//left// folder and //right// folder) and to keep them synchronized | ||
| - | * Click on Create New Folder Pair | + | * Click on //Create New Folder Pair// |
| - | * Choose a Left Folder on the computer\\ e.g. F: | + | * Choose a //Left Folder// **on the computer**\\ e.g. '' |
| - | * Choose a Right Folder on the backup disk\\ e.g. J: | + | * Choose a //Right Folder// **on the backup disk**\\ e.g. '' |
| - | * Click Next and choose Echo, because we want the backup to be an exact copy of the original folder | + | * Click //Next// and choose |
| - | * Click Next and give a meaningful name to the folder pair\\ e.g. \< | + | * Warning! //Exact copy// means that if something is removed in the //left// folder and you run synctoy, synctoy will also erase the same thing in the // |
| + | * Click Next and give a meaningful name to the folder pair\\ e.g. '' | ||
| * Finish... | * Finish... | ||
| - | * Select the folder pair and click on Change options | + | * Select the folder pair and click on //Change options// |
| - | * Enable Exclude system files | + | * Enable |
| - | * Disable Save overwritten files in the Recycle Bin | + | * Disable |
| - | * Click on Preview and check the list of actions that the backup program will use | + | * Click on //Preview// and check the list of actions that the backup program will use |
| * Click on Run | * Click on Run | ||
| + | |||
| + | ===== Google Drive ===== | ||
| + | |||
| + | Web & Download: https:// | ||
| ===== VLC ===== | ===== VLC ===== | ||
| Line 224: | Line 322: | ||
| Download: http:// | Download: http:// | ||
| + | |||
| + | ===== BlueScreenView ===== | ||
| + | |||
| + | This utility makes it possible to display information about previous crashes of a Win computer. Use this if your PC has experienced a BSOD (//Blue Screen of Death//) and you want to know what happened | ||
| + | |||
| + | Web & Download: http:// | ||
| + | |||
| + | ===== HTTrack Website Copier ===== | ||
| + | |||
| + | This utility makes it possible to download a web site for backup (e.g. HTML backup/ | ||
| + | |||
| + | Web & Download: http:// | ||
| + | |||
| /* standard page footer */ | /* standard page footer */ | ||
other/win7apps.1415269283.txt.gz · Last modified: by jypeter
